Choosing the Best Pool Chlorinator: A Complete Guide

Selecting the perfect pool chemical feeder can feel complex, but understanding the different types is essential. Salt generators generate chlorine naturally, offering a convenient approach while requiring a significant cost. Standard chlorinators, like chlorine feeders and automatic liquid feeders, are generally more affordable and basic to set up, but require frequent maintenance. Consider your water's size, financial plan, and desired level of automation when making your decision.

Troubleshooting Common Pool Chlorinator Problems

Experiencing problems with your pool chlorinator? Don't fret! Several typical malfunctions can be easily corrected with a little troubleshooting . A insufficient of chlorine, demonstrated via unclear water or a high pH level, often implies a blocked salt cell, a defective float switch, or an incorrect chlorinator setting. Check the generator's leads for any corrosion and ensure the solution is flowing properly. You might also be asked to clean the salt cell with a specific cleaning compound. If these actions don't remedy the problem , it's prudent to consult a experienced aquatic technician for further assistance .
